Hawaii Has Highest Life Expectancy In The US, West Virginia The Lowest
Life expectancy varies widely across the U.S., with clear regional patterns emerging in the latest data.
States in the Northeast and on the West Coast tend to have higher life expectancies, while many in the South and Appalachia rank lower.
This map, via Visual Capitalist's Niccolo Conte, shows these differences using data from the CDC’s National Center for Health Statistics, based on 2022 life tables published in December 2025, the latest publicly available state-level figures as of March 2026.

Iran Says US Violated Ceasefire and Vows It Will ‘Leave No Act of Aggression Unanswered’
The Iranian Foreign Ministry said in a statement on Tuesday that the US committed a “flagrant violation” of the ceasefire between the US and Iran, a statement that came a day after the US military said that it launched strikes against targets in southern Iran.
